Oracle Database Administrator

Location: Saint Paul, MN

Job Description:

Client is seeking one full-time resource to provide Oracle Database Administration for all 3 agencies, with each agency having its own competing priorities with an influx of database administration work requiring skills of senior Oracle database administrators.

Responsibilities:

  • Support implementation of system modernization efforts.
  • Development of new database environments.
  • Support concurrent cycles of code development and deployment: quality assurance, performance/load testing, troubleshooting, and training.
  • Work closely with state staff to ensure systems modernization efforts are completed accurately and on-time.
  • Provide technology solutions that are reliable and flexible to meet fluctuating business partner demands and expectations.
  • Responsibilities include design, establish, and maintain database structures and views and ensure data integrity.
  • Evaluate, recommend, plan, install, test, and maintain vendor software and hardware products used to support the Oracle database environment.
  • Conduct database deploys in new and existing environments.
  • Implement new database environments.
  • Develop scripts for Automating Daily DBA tasks.
  • Complete database support requests from developers, Tier II help desk, user security administration, and other system administrators.
  • Triaging break/fix help desk tickets.
  • Database Administrator for state and federally funded projects for all database administration work.
  • Completing work for new database environments.
  • Troubleshooting database environment issues.
  • Working with all IT disciplines (QA, BA, Dev, Project Mgmt.) on Oracle database projects.
  • Provide knowledge transfer

Required Skills:

  • Advanced/Expert standard Oracle Database Administration experience.
  • Advanced/Expert experience with scripting languages.
  • Advanced/Expert experience working with IBM Rational Change and Configuration Management (CCM).
  • Advanced/Expert experience resolving Oracle database security findings from security audits.
  • Advanced/Expert experience in planning and implementing technology solutions.
  • Advanced/Expert experience working with quality assurance, business analysis, and performance/load testing.
  • Advanced/Expert experience troubleshooting Oracle Database issues.
